PROCEDURE

实验过程

(Z)-7-Chloro-3-(2-chlorobenzyl)-1-(4-methoxybenzyl)-5-(2-oxo-2,3-dihydro-1H-benzo[d]imidazol-5-yl)-1H-benzo[e][1,4]diazepin-2(3H)-one (200 mg, 0.35 mmol) was dissolved in anhydrous anisole (4 mL) under a nitrogen atmosphere, aluminum chloride (280 mg, 2.1 mmol) was added and the mixture was heated to 85° C. for 1 hour. The solution was cooled to ambient temperature, poured onto ice, rinsing the flask with ethyl acetate and water. The mixture was slurried for 10 minutes. The layers were separated and the aqueous layer was extracted with ethyl acetate. The combined organic layers were washed with brine, dried with sodium sulfate, decanted and concentrated in the presence of silica gel. The residue was chromatographed on silica gel eluting with 70-100% ethyl acetate in hexanes switching to a gradient of 0-10% methanol in ethyl acetate to give (Z)-7-chloro-3-(2-chlorobenzyl)-5-(2-oxo-2,3-dihydro-1H-benzo[d]imidazol-5-yl)-1H-benzo[e][1,4]diazepin-2(3H)-one (70 mg, 44%). 1H NMR (300 MHz, DMSO-d6) δ 3.46 (d, 2H) 3.76 (t, 1H), 6.90 (m, 2H), 7.01 (s, 1H) 7.21-7.64 (m, 7H), 10.70 (s, 1H), 10.74 (s, 1H), 10.85 (s, 1H); ESI m/z measured 451.0736 [M+H+], calculated 451.0729.
